Introduction to Qunyutang: "Qunyutang Tie" was engraved during the Jiatai and Kaixi years of the Southern Song Dynasty (1201-1207). It was originally called "Yegutang Tie" and later changed to "Qunyutang Tie". It has ten volumes in total. The complete text is no longer available today. Book. This re-engraving uses the fragments of the Song Dynasty's "Qunyu Tang Tie" collected by the Palace Museum, as well as fragments of old collections and fragments, which is extremely valuable. A total of 22 works. The plaque in front of the hall is a copy of the calligraphy of Wang Duo, a famous calligrapher and painter in the late Ming and early Qing dynasties.
